NON-CALCULATOR PART

4. The mean value theorem says that for a function F continuous on an interval [a,b] and differentiable on (a,b), there is some c\in(a,b) such that

F'(c)=\dfrac{F(b)-F(a)}{b-a}

If this F happens to be an antiderivative of f, then we end up with

f(c)=\displaystyle\frac1{b-a}\int_a^bf(x)\,\mathrm dx

\cos x is continuous and differentiable everywhere, so the MVT applies. We have F'(x)=f(x)=\cos x, so the MVT tells us there is some c\in[0,\pi such that

\cos c=\dfrac{\sin\pi-\sin0}{\pi-0}=0

That is, the average value of f(x) on [0,\pi] is 0. The MVT says there is some c in the interval such that the function takes on the average value itself; this happens for c=\frac\pi2.

The part of the spectrum that can be separated into rainbow-like colors is ...?
Rufina [12.5K]

Answer: Visible light spectrum.

Explanation: On the entire electromagnetic spectrum, the human eye can only detect and view the visible light spectrum which is what we, as humans, can separate into “rainbow-like colors.”

PKEASE HELP!!!!!!! what are a few reasons why the south seceded from the union
zvonat [6]

The scholars immediately disagreed over the causes of the war and they still disagree today.

Many maintain that the main cause of the was that the southern states desired to preserve the institution of slavery.

Others minimize slavery and point to other issues, taxation and principle of States' rights.
